Spotify Launched in Germany Without Key Licensing Deal

  • Frederic Lardinois
  • Posted on March 13, 2012

Spotify, the popular streaming music service, launched in Germany today. The company had been planning this launch for a while and had already been operating a German-language version in Austria since last year. Quite a few pundits assumed that the delay was due to rights negotiations with the German royalty collection agency GEMA. This organization is…

Apple’s iBooks Author EULA: What’s the Big Deal?

  • Frederic Lardinois
  • Posted on January 19, 2012

I've been following the heated discussion around the license agreement for Apple's new iBooks Author tool that lets budding publishers create their own iBooks for Apple iBookstore. Apple basically says that if you create an eBook for the iBookstore with the app, you can't take the iBook file you created with the tool (or the PDF…
